Understanding Uniform Linen: What Is It?
Uniform linen refers to the specialized textiles that are used in the uniforms of staff members across various hospitality sectors. These textiles may include items such as aprons, tablecloths, bed linens, and employees' uniforms, all designed to ensure that the staff presents a cohesive, professional look while effectively performing their duties. Understanding the intricate details of uniform linen helps businesses invest wisely in their dining or service areas.
Types of Uniform Linen
In the hospitality industry, different types of uniform linen are essential to cater to diverse needs. Here's a closer look at some common categories:
- Kitchen Linen: Includes aprons, chef coats, and hats made from durable, stain-resistant fabric.
- Service Linen: Comprises uniforms for front-of-house staff, such as shirts, blouses, vests, and ties that project professionalism.
- Table Linen: Encompasses tablecloths, napkins, and other textile items that contribute to the overall dining experience.
- Bed Linen: Vital for hotels and lodges, including sheets, pillowcases, and duvet covers that ensure guests enjoy a comfortable stay.

Cleaning and Maintenance of Uniform Linen
Proper care and maintenance of uniform linen not only enhance its appearance but also extend its lifespan. Here are some cleaning tips to keep in mind:
- Follow Care Labels: Always adhere to the specific care instructions that come with the uniform linen.
- Regular Washing: Frequent washing helps to maintain hygiene, particularly for kitchen and service linen.
- Stain Treatment: Address stains promptly using suitable stain removal products to avoid permanent damage.
- Gentle Drying: Use low heat settings when drying to prevent shrinking or damaging the fabric.
The Future of Uniform Linen in the Hospitality Industry
The landscape of the hospitality industry is ever-evolving, influenced by trends that affect customer preferences and environmental concerns. Here are some trends to watch regarding uniform linen:
1. Sustainable Materials
Eco-friendly fabrics are becoming increasingly popular. Many establishments are now focusing on materials made from organic cotton or recycled fibers, significantly reducing their environmental footprint.
2. Functional Design
As operational efficiency becomes more critical, manufacturers are developing uniform linen that integrates multifunctional designs. For example, uniforms with pockets, moisture-wicking properties, or anti-wrinkle finishes help staff perform their duties more effectively.
3. Technological Integration
Innovations in textiles, such as the incorporation of antimicrobial properties or stain-resistant coatings, enhance the quality and durability of uniform linen. These technologies protect staff and improve hygiene, critical in today's health-conscious world.
